<?xml version="1.0" encoding="UTF-8"?>
<rss xmlns:content="http://purl.org/rss/1.0/modules/content/" xmlns:dc="http://purl.org/dc/elements/1.1/" xmlns:rdf="http://www.w3.org/1999/02/22-rdf-syntax-ns#" xmlns:taxo="http://purl.org/rss/1.0/modules/taxonomy/" version="2.0">
  <channel>
    <title>topic Re: How to determine the first observation in a data set in SAS Programming</title>
    <link>https://communities.sas.com/t5/SAS-Programming/How-to-determine-the-first-observation-in-a-data-set/m-p/168867#M32409</link>
    <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;That works fine: if _n_=1 then do ... Thanks Reeza. One somewhat related follow up, when I increment using lag, it is not working in this instance. Do yo or anyone usually use lag for something like this?&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Paul&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;data uniquemediator1;&lt;/P&gt;&lt;P&gt;set uniquemediator;&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;if _n_=1 then do;&lt;/P&gt;&lt;P&gt;MedNum=1;&lt;/P&gt;&lt;P&gt;end;&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;if _n_ ne 1 then do;&lt;/P&gt;&lt;P&gt;MedNum=lag(MedNum)+1;&lt;/P&gt;&lt;P&gt;end;&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;run;&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
    <pubDate>Fri, 13 Feb 2015 20:30:03 GMT</pubDate>
    <dc:creator>Paul_NYS</dc:creator>
    <dc:date>2015-02-13T20:30:03Z</dc:date>
    <item>
      <title>How to determine the first observation in a data set</title>
      <link>https://communities.sas.com/t5/SAS-Programming/How-to-determine-the-first-observation-in-a-data-set/m-p/168865#M32407</link>
      <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;I want to add a simple sequence number to a data set with no 'by' variable. Does anyone know how to identify the first observation in a data set so I can set this to zero and everything following it will just be an increment?&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Paul&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
      <pubDate>Fri, 13 Feb 2015 20:16:16 GMT</pubDate>
      <guid>https://communities.sas.com/t5/SAS-Programming/How-to-determine-the-first-observation-in-a-data-set/m-p/168865#M32407</guid>
      <dc:creator>Paul_NYS</dc:creator>
      <dc:date>2015-02-13T20:16:16Z</dc:date>
    </item>
    <item>
      <title>Re: How to determine the first observation in a data set</title>
      <link>https://communities.sas.com/t5/SAS-Programming/How-to-determine-the-first-observation-in-a-data-set/m-p/168866#M32408</link>
      <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;if _n_=1 then do ..&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;or initialize with retain statement&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;retain obs 0&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;You can also try:&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Sequence=_n_;&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
      <pubDate>Fri, 13 Feb 2015 20:19:03 GMT</pubDate>
      <guid>https://communities.sas.com/t5/SAS-Programming/How-to-determine-the-first-observation-in-a-data-set/m-p/168866#M32408</guid>
      <dc:creator>Reeza</dc:creator>
      <dc:date>2015-02-13T20:19:03Z</dc:date>
    </item>
    <item>
      <title>Re: How to determine the first observation in a data set</title>
      <link>https://communities.sas.com/t5/SAS-Programming/How-to-determine-the-first-observation-in-a-data-set/m-p/168867#M32409</link>
      <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;That works fine: if _n_=1 then do ... Thanks Reeza. One somewhat related follow up, when I increment using lag, it is not working in this instance. Do yo or anyone usually use lag for something like this?&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Paul&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;data uniquemediator1;&lt;/P&gt;&lt;P&gt;set uniquemediator;&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;if _n_=1 then do;&lt;/P&gt;&lt;P&gt;MedNum=1;&lt;/P&gt;&lt;P&gt;end;&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;if _n_ ne 1 then do;&lt;/P&gt;&lt;P&gt;MedNum=lag(MedNum)+1;&lt;/P&gt;&lt;P&gt;end;&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;run;&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
      <pubDate>Fri, 13 Feb 2015 20:30:03 GMT</pubDate>
      <guid>https://communities.sas.com/t5/SAS-Programming/How-to-determine-the-first-observation-in-a-data-set/m-p/168867#M32409</guid>
      <dc:creator>Paul_NYS</dc:creator>
      <dc:date>2015-02-13T20:30:03Z</dc:date>
    </item>
    <item>
      <title>Re: How to determine the first observation in a data set</title>
      <link>https://communities.sas.com/t5/SAS-Programming/How-to-determine-the-first-observation-in-a-data-set/m-p/168868#M32410</link>
      <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;Lag doesn't work in conditional if/then statements. There are papers written on this topic so you can search for those if you're interested. &l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;I would use the following myself:&lt;/P&gt;&lt;P&gt;MedNum=_n_; &l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
      <pubDate>Fri, 13 Feb 2015 20:40:04 GMT</pubDate>
      <guid>https://communities.sas.com/t5/SAS-Programming/How-to-determine-the-first-observation-in-a-data-set/m-p/168868#M32410</guid>
      <dc:creator>Reeza</dc:creator>
      <dc:date>2015-02-13T20:40:04Z</dc:date>
    </item>
    <item>
      <title>Re: How to determine the first observation in a data set</title>
      <link>https://communities.sas.com/t5/SAS-Programming/How-to-determine-the-first-observation-in-a-data-set/m-p/168869#M32411</link>
      <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;Thanks Reeza. I think I remember that now actually. Sorry and thanks again.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;And the _n_ works nicely when you don't need a 'by' variable grouping.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Paul&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
      <pubDate>Fri, 13 Feb 2015 20:45:48 GMT</pubDate>
      <guid>https://communities.sas.com/t5/SAS-Programming/How-to-determine-the-first-observation-in-a-data-set/m-p/168869#M32411</guid>
      <dc:creator>Paul_NYS</dc:creator>
      <dc:date>2015-02-13T20:45:48Z</dc:date>
    </item>
  </channel>
</rss>

